Congress manifesto for Lok Sabha election 2019 raises more questions than hope
With less than a week left for the elections, the largest opposition party Congress finally released its much awaited manifesto for the 2019 Lok Sabha Elections describing it as the ‘voice of the people’ which seeks to sharply differentiate the grand-old-part party from the BJP by promising to scrap the sedition law, dilute AFSPA and withdraw the citizenship amendment bill, alongside offering populist pledges on minimum income support for all poor families, improved healthcare, jobs and education.
